COLUMBUS, Miss. (WCBI) – The bonds have been issued but it’ll likely be October before Columbus residents see the start of a major street improvement program. City engineers are finalizing details and plans for dozens of streets and sidewalks but those plans likely won’t be finished for other two weeks. Bids will be taken at the end of the month and awarded in late September. That will leave contractors about three months of work before winter arrives. The city council issued five million in bonds last month to pay for the work. After fees and bond costs, about four and a half million remains for.
